dc.description The author calculates the lowest-order conduction electron vertex function Gamma of an Anderson lattice in the Kondo regime. There is a strong repulsion between a pair of opposite-spin electrons due to scattering from a single magnetic ion. The lowest-order attractive interaction is found to be between a pair of parallel-spin electrons and is due to scattering from two magnetic ions. The distance dependence is R<sup>-2</sup> instead of R<sup>-3</sup> as the usual RKKY interaction, so this interaction is longer-range.
